If there is no  physical reason for his not eating then you've inadvertantly
trained him to handfeeding and you'll have to retrain him to eat solid food.
Isolate him so that he can have the food dish to himself. Then put a dish of
food in front of him and do not handfeed no matter how much he fusses. He'll
eat if he gets hungry and there is food in front of him. He may take a day
to finally eat. It might help to put Ensure (vanilla flavor) over his food
so he can lap this up. Don't put too much, just enough to get him started.

Just be sure that he is physically capable of eating before trying the
retraining.

> I have a little 8 week old puppy boy who is absolutely refusing to eat
solid
> food.  His mom is ready to wean the litter, and all of them have happily
> moved on to solids.  This little boy is refusing to eat.  I have tried
baby
> meat, raw turkey, cooked chicken, canned puppy food, kibble, and cheese.
He
> is perfectly capable of eating but simply won't.  He wants to nurse the
rest
> of his life.  He doesn't mind if I syringe in Esbilac but I am finding
that
> to be rather time consuming.  He thinks the baby food is pretty good as
long
> as I put dabs of it on his tongue.  He follows me around all day wanting
me
> to pick him up and he barks at me when I won't.  Does anyone have any
> suggestions for me to try?  Myra
